About This Coffee

A single-origin coffee from the Central Valley region of Costa Rica, grown by producer Mario Barquero at 1300–1500 meters above sea level. The coffee is the Milenio variety, processed using the Anaerobic Natural method. Light roasted, it presents tasting notes of plum, grapefruit, and floral characteristics. Suitable for all brewing methods.

Rye Island Roastery

Rye Island Roastery was officially founded in June 2020 on Žitný Ostrov, the large river island in southwestern Slovakia known for its peaceful agricultural landscape. The team had been building roasting experience well before the launch date, and they work on a Garanti roaster, adapting each profile to the character and origin of the bean to achieve clean, clear cups with distinctive flavor. From those local beginnings the roastery has built a customer base that now extends beyond Slovakia's borders, driven by a philosophy that balances precision with a willingness to experiment. Their catalog rotates seasonally, and the company positions itself as a community that invites drinkers to discover new dimensions of the coffee world alongside them.
